Cultural tourism refers to the various ways in which people travel to visit cultural sites and to experience a different culture, rather than just sightseeing. In Seoul, cultural tourism has become a popular form of tourism, as the city is filled with many cultural sites and is a melting pot of many different cultures. The city is a hub for cultural tourism and has a large number of museums and cultural institutions it offers.

Seoul is a place that is rich in culture. There are many different forms of cultural tourism that people can partake in. One of the most popular forms of cultural tourism in Seoul is the traditional hanbok. This is a traditional Korean garment that is worn by men and women. It is not just a garment, it is a part of the culture. There are many different activities that are associated with the traditional hanbok. One of the most popular is the hanbok dance, which is a traditional Korean dance that is performed by men and women. Other popular forms of cultural tourism in Seoul include visiting museums, visiting traditional markets, and going on a walking tour.
